    Can you please recommend special things to do for a little girl’s fifth birthday?

    Hi Jenny,

    Welcome to the Disney Parks Moms Panel! Hooray for birthday celebrations! Going to the Walt Disney World Resort to celebrate is, of course, the BEST PRESENT EVER! 

    There are lots of fun ways to celebrate while you are there. I like to say there is a Jedi path or a Princess path to follow. Our girls do both. If you have a little one who seeks to protect the galaxy, plan a Star Wars day that begins with Jedi Training - Trials of the Temple. Then fly through the galaxy on Star Tours - The Adventures Continue and visit with her favorite characters at Star Wars Launch Bay. When our girls prefer to princess through the parks, they put on their royal attire and stroll down Main Street, U.S.A. in Magic Kingdom. Along the way, cast members love to greet them by saying "Hello princess!" We stop by Princess Fairytale Hall to visit with Rapunzel and Tiana and then we dine at Cinderella's Royal Table. 

    Or, for an alternate princess experience, take her to Princess Storybook dining at Akershus Royal Banquet Hall in Epcot. Then take a tour of Arendelle on Frozen Ever After and visit with Anna and Elsa at Royal Sommerhus. Be sure to note her birthday celebration on your dining reservations. We have received birthday cards signed by the characters and mini cupcakes at several restaurants.  Also, consider ordering one of the Mickey Mouse celebration Cakes at Walt Disney World Resort

    Jenny, on our last visit, we also took our girls on the Caring for Giants tour to see the elephants in Disney's Animal Kingdom. They adore baby Stella!
